Complete the equation of the line through (-6, 5) and (-3, -3)
Answer:
y = -8/3x - 11
Step-by-step explanation:
(-6, 5) and (-3, -3)
Slope:
m=(y2-y1)/(x2-x1)
m=(-3-5)/(-3+6)
m=(-8)/3
m= -8/3
Slope-intercept:
y - y1 = m(x - x1)
y - 5 = -8/3(x + 6)
y - 5 = -8/3x - 16
y = -8/3x - 11

If the perimeter of a square is 20, find the length of a diagonal. Round your answer to the nearest tenth.
7.7
7.1
6.3
8.4
Answer:
option 2] 7. 1
Step-by-step explanation:
Perimeter of square is 20.
therefore,
[tex]perimeter \: = 4 \times side \\ therefore \: 20 = 4 \times side \\ \: \: \: \: \: \: side = \frac{20}{4} \: = 5 [/tex]
the diagonal and the Two adjacent sides of the square form a right angle triangle, so,
By hypotenuse theorem,
[tex] {iagonal}^{2} \: = {side1}^{2} + {side2 }^{2} \\ \: \: \: \: \: \: \: \: = {5}^{2} + {5 }^{2} \\ = 25 + 25....(as \: suare \: has \: equal \: sides \: i.e \: 5) \\ = 50 \\diagonal = \sqrt{50} \\ = \sqrt{25 \times 2} \\ = 5 \sqrt{2 } \\ = 5 \times 1.414 \\ = 7.07 \\ = approx \: 7.1[/tex]

There is a method of solving proportions that is called "cross multiply" or "cross multiplication". For a proportion like this it looks like each numerator is multiplied by the opposite denominator. In this problem, the result would be ...
7(350) = (10)x
While "cross multiplication" is a description of the appearance of what is happening, what is really happening is that both sides of the equation are being multiplied by the same value: the product of the denominators. This is in accordance with the multiplication property of equality, which requires you multiply both sides of the equation by the same value.
__
The error that was made in this problem is that each numerator was multiplied by its own denominator. Effectively, that multiplied the left side of the equation by 10² = 100, and the right side of the equation by 350² = 122500. This is in direct violation of the multiplication property of equality, so guarantees the value found for x will be wrong.
__
While "cross multiply" is an instruction often given for solving proportions, it causes an extra step to be needed in solving a proportion like this one. All that is really needed is to multiply both sides of the equation by the denominator under the variable. Here, that means multiplying both sides of the equation by 350.
Correct solution
[tex]\dfrac{7}{10}=\dfrac{x}{350}\\\\350\cdot\dfrac{7}{10}=350\cdot\dfrac{x}{350}\\\\\\35\cdot 7=\boxed{x=245}[/tex]

You are a laboratory technician. You are filling spherical flasks with a salt solution and then putting them into boxes. Each flask has a volume of 113.04 cubic inches.
Rounded to the nearest tenth of an inch, what is the radius of one flask?
3.0
3.6
5.2
6.4
6.9
Answer:
3.0 inches
Step-by-step explanation:
The formula for the volume of a sphere is
V = 4/3 × π × r³
V = 113.04 cubic inches
To find r
r = (3V/4π)⅓
r = (3 × 113.04/4 × π )⅓
r = 3.0 inches
The radius of one flask = 3.0 inches
Option A is correct
